static const char *none_prefix[] = { NULL };
static const char *siminit_prefix[] = { "%ISIMINIT:", NULL };
static const char *ussdmode_prefix[] = { "%IUSSDMODE:", NULL };
struct icera_data {
GAtChat *chat;
struct ofono_sim *sim;
gboolean have_sim;
gboolean have_ussdmode;
};
static int icera_probe(struct ofono_modem *modem)
{
struct icera_data *data;
DBG("%p", modem);
data = g_try_new0(struct icera_data, 1);
if (data == NULL)
return -ENOMEM;
ofono_modem_set_data(modem, data);
return 0;
}
static void icera_remove(struct ofono_modem *modem)
{
struct icera_data *data = ofono_modem_get_data(modem);
DBG("%p", modem);
ofono_modem_set_data(modem, NULL);
/* Cleanup after hot-unplug */
g_at_chat_unref(data->chat);
g_free(data);
}
static void icera_debug(const char *str, void *user_data)
{
const char *prefix = user_data;
ofono_info("%s%s", prefix, str);
}
static GAtChat *open_device(struct ofono_modem *modem,
const char *key, char *debug)
{
return at_util_open_device(modem, key, icera_debug, debug,
"Baud", "115200",
NULL);
}
static void ussdmode_query(gboolean ok, GAtResult *result,
gpointer user_data)
{
struct ofono_modem *modem = user_data;
struct icera_data *data = ofono_modem_get_data(modem);
GAtResultIter iter;
int mode;
if (!ok)
return;
g_at_result_iter_init(&iter, result);
if (!g_at_result_iter_next(&iter, "%IUSSDMODE:"))
return;
if (!g_at_result_iter_next_number(&iter, &mode))
return;
DBG("mode %d", mode);
if (mode == 1)
data->have_ussdmode = TRUE;
}
static void ussdmode_support(gboolean ok, GAtResult *result,
gpointer user_data)
{
struct ofono_modem *modem = user_data;
struct icera_data *data = ofono_modem_get_data(modem);
GAtResultIter iter;
if (!ok)
return;
g_at_result_iter_init(&iter, result);
if (!g_at_result_iter_next(&iter, "%IUSSDMODE:"))
return;
g_at_chat_send(data->chat, "AT%IUSSDMODE?", ussdmode_prefix,
ussdmode_query, modem, NULL);
}
static void icera_set_sim_state(struct icera_data *data, int state)
{
DBG("state %d", state);
switch (state) {
case 1:
if (data->have_sim == FALSE) {
ofono_sim_inserted_notify(data->sim, TRUE);
data->have_sim = TRUE;
}
break;
case 0:
case 2:
if (data->have_sim == TRUE) {
ofono_sim_inserted_notify(data->sim, FALSE);
data->have_sim = FALSE;
}
break;
default:
ofono_warn("Unknown SIM state %d received", state);
break;
}
}
static void siminit_notify(GAtResult *result, gpointer user_data)
{
struct ofono_modem *modem = user_data;
struct icera_data *data = ofono_modem_get_data(modem);
GAtResultIter iter;
int state;
if (data->sim == NULL)
return;
g_at_result_iter_init(&iter, result);
if (!g_at_result_iter_next(&iter, "%ISIMINIT:"))
return;
if (!g_at_result_iter_next_number(&iter, &state))
return;
icera_set_sim_state(data, state);
}
static void siminit_query(gboolean ok, GAtResult *result, gpointer user_data)
{
struct ofono_modem *modem = user_data;
struct icera_data *data = ofono_modem_get_data(modem);
GAtResultIter iter;
int state;
DBG("");
if (!ok)
return;
g_at_result_iter_init(&iter, result);
if (!g_at_result_iter_next(&iter, "%ISIMINIT:"))
return;
if (!g_at_result_iter_next_number(&iter, &state))
return;
icera_set_sim_state(data, state);
}
static void cfun_enable(gboolean ok, GAtResult *result, gpointer user_data)
{
struct ofono_modem *modem = user_data;
struct icera_data *data = ofono_modem_get_data(modem);
DBG("");
if (!ok) {
g_at_chat_unref(data->chat);
data->chat = NULL;
ofono_modem_set_powered(modem, FALSE);
return;
}
/* switch to GSM character set instead of IRA */
g_at_chat_send(data->chat, "AT+CSCS=\"GSM\"", none_prefix,
NULL, NULL, NULL);
data->have_sim = FALSE;
/* notify that the modem is ready so that pre_sim gets called */
ofono_modem_set_powered(modem, TRUE);
/* register for SIM init notifications */
g_at_chat_register(data->chat, "%ISIMINIT:", siminit_notify,
FALSE, modem, NULL);
g_at_chat_send(data->chat, "AT%ISIMINIT=1", none_prefix,
NULL, NULL, NULL);
g_at_chat_send(data->chat, "AT%ISIMINIT", siminit_prefix,
siminit_query, modem, NULL);
g_at_chat_send(data->chat, "AT%IAIRCRAFT?", none_prefix,
NULL, NULL, NULL);
}
static int icera_enable(struct ofono_modem *modem)
{
struct icera_data *data = ofono_modem_get_data(modem);
DBG("%p", modem);
data->chat = open_device(modem, "Aux", "Aux: ");
if (data->chat == NULL)
return -EIO;
g_at_chat_send(data->chat, "ATE0 +CMEE=1", NULL, NULL, NULL, NULL);
g_at_chat_send(data->chat, "AT%IFWR", none_prefix, NULL, NULL, NULL);
g_at_chat_send(data->chat, "AT%ISWIN", none_prefix, NULL, NULL, NULL);
g_at_chat_send(data->chat, "AT%IUSSDMODE=?", ussdmode_prefix,
ussdmode_support, modem, NULL);
g_at_chat_send(data->chat, "AT+CFUN=4", none_prefix,
cfun_enable, modem, NULL);
return -EINPROGRESS;
}
static void cfun_disable(gboolean ok, GAtResult *result, gpointer user_data)
{
struct ofono_modem *modem = user_data;
struct icera_data *data = ofono_modem_get_data(modem);
DBG("");
g_at_chat_unref(data->chat);
data->chat = NULL;
if (ok)
ofono_modem_set_powered(modem, FALSE);
}
static int icera_disable(struct ofono_modem *modem)
{
struct icera_data *data = ofono_modem_get_data(modem);
DBG("%p", modem);
g_at_chat_cancel_all(data->chat);
g_at_chat_unregister_all(data->chat);
g_at_chat_send(data->chat, "AT+CFUN=0", none_prefix,
cfun_disable, modem, NULL);
return -EINPROGRESS;
}
static void set_online_cb(gboolean ok, GAtResult *result, gpointer user_data)
{
struct cb_data *cbd = user_data;
ofono_modem_online_cb_t cb = cbd->cb;
struct ofono_error error;
decode_at_error(&error, g_at_result_final_response(result));
cb(&error, cbd->data);
}
static void icera_set_online(struct ofono_modem *modem, ofono_bool_t online,
ofono_modem_online_cb_t cb, void *user_data)
{
struct icera_data *data = ofono_modem_get_data(modem);
struct cb_data *cbd = cb_data_new(cb, user_data);
char const *command = online ? "AT+CFUN=1" : "AT+CFUN=4";
DBG("%p %s", modem, online ? "online" : "offline");
if (g_at_chat_send(data->chat, command, none_prefix,
set_online_cb, cbd, g_free) > 0)
return;
CALLBACK_WITH_FAILURE(cb, cbd->data);
g_free(cbd);
}
static void icera_pre_sim(struct ofono_modem *modem)
{
struct icera_data *data = ofono_modem_get_data(modem);
DBG("%p", modem);
ofono_devinfo_create(modem, 0, "atmodem", data->chat);
data->sim = ofono_sim_create(modem, OFONO_VENDOR_ICERA,
"atmodem", data->chat);
}
static void icera_post_sim(struct ofono_modem *modem)
{
struct icera_data *data = ofono_modem_get_data(modem);
struct ofono_gprs *gprs;
struct ofono_gprs_context *gc;
DBG("%p", modem);
ofono_radio_settings_create(modem, 0, "iceramodem", data->chat);
ofono_sms_create(modem, OFONO_VENDOR_ICERA, "atmodem", data->chat);
gprs = ofono_gprs_create(modem, OFONO_VENDOR_ICERA,
"atmodem", data->chat);
gc = ofono_gprs_context_create(modem, 0, "iceramodem", data->chat);
if (gprs && gc)
ofono_gprs_add_context(gprs, gc);
}
static void icera_post_online(struct ofono_modem *modem)
{
struct icera_data *data = ofono_modem_get_data(modem);
DBG("%p", modem);
ofono_netreg_create(modem, OFONO_VENDOR_ICERA, "atmodem", data->chat);
if (data->have_ussdmode == TRUE)
ofono_ussd_create(modem, 0, "huaweimodem", data->chat);
else
ofono_ussd_create(modem, 0, "atmodem", data->chat);
}
static struct ofono_modem_driver icera_driver = {
.name = "icera",
.probe = icera_probe,
.remove = icera_remove,
.enable = icera_enable,
.disable = icera_disable,
.set_online = icera_set_online,
.pre_sim = icera_pre_sim,
.post_sim = icera_post_sim,
.post_online = icera_post_online,
};
static int icera_init(void)
{
return ofono_modem_driver_register(&icera_driver);
}
static void icera_exit(void)
{
ofono_modem_driver_unregister(&icera_driver);
}
OFONO_PLUGIN_DEFINE(icera, "Icera modem driver", VERSION,
OFONO_PLUGIN_PRIORITY_DEFAULT, icera_init, icera_exit)
